Cloud + production reliability
Create useful application logs, end-user availability checks, and actionable alerts tied to system ownership and recovery paths.
The operating context
More alerts do not create reliability. Zyel starts with the user paths and failure modes that matter, then captures enough context to distinguish symptoms, causes, impact, and the action an owner should take.
